Wilko Johnson was an English guitarist and singer, renowned for his distinctive fingerstyle guitar technique that allowed him to play rhythm and lead simultaneously. He was a founding member of Dr. Feelgood, a pivotal band in the 1970s pub rock scene. After departing Dr. Feelgood in 1977, he pursued a solo career with his own band and collaborated with various artists, including Roger Daltrey of The Who.
